Token Economy
A behavior modification system based on the systematic reinforcement of target behavior through the issuance of tokens that can be exchanged for desired rewards.
Contingency Contract
A formal, written agreement between the therapist and client (or teacher and student) in which goals for behavioral change, reinforcements, and penalties are clearly stated.
Systematic Desensitization
A behavioral therapy technique used to reduce phobias through gradual exposure to the feared object or situation paired with relaxation techniques.
Person-Centered Therapy
A therapeutic approach founded by Carl Rogers that emphasizes an individual's self-worth and values being at the center of the therapy process.
